Mission: To act as the base of a communications network among eops staff, students, advisory committees, the chancellor's office staff, and other groups that serve eops students in community colleges. To communicate the needs of the eops program, to assist in implementing statewide policies, programs and regulations. To encourage and participate in additional programs at the local, state levels to assist disadvantaged students.
Programs: Annual conference enables members to plan, implement and evaluate campus programs. In addition the members approve and confirm amendments relating to budget and ccceopsa board positions.
executive board oversees the purpose of the organization with monthly meetings, annual retreat, publication of newsletter and provides legislative support.
spring training provides members with possible changes and facilitates discussion relating to the ccceopsa guidelines. The training also promotes advocacy within their campuses. The chancellor's office disseminates information regarding the following: the success of eops students, dream act students, and the unique needs of each of the community colleges in california.
